ESC M

Selects 10.5 point. 12 CPI. (EPSON)

ASCII Code

ESC M

Hexadecimal Value

1B 4D

Decimal Value

27 77

This is a terminator code. It causes all data present in the print buffer to be printed. Subsequent
data will be printed at 12 cpi if you previously set the compressed spacing by sending the SI or
ESC SI command. If you select the proportional printing, this command is stored.

ESC m

Selects magenta ribbon band. (IBM)

ASCII Code

ESC m

Hexadecimal Value

1B 6D

Decimal Value

27 109

This command selects the magenta ribbon band.

ESC P

Selects 10.5 point, 10 cpi. (EPSON)

ASCII Code

ESC P

n

Hexadecimal Value

1B 50

n

Decimal Value

27 80

n

This command selects 10.5-point, 10-cpi character printing. If you change the pitch during
proportional mode (selected with the ESC p command) the change takes effect when the printer
exits proportional mode.
